The Educational Foundation

Before specializing in neuroradiology, one must first complete the standard medical education pathway. This begins with a four-year undergraduate degree, where aspiring doctors focus on pre-medical sciences to build a strong academic foundation. Following this, admission to medical school is highly competitive, requiring four years of intensive study to earn an MD or DO degree. The journey continues with the USMLE or COMLEX exams, which are critical milestones for medical licensure and residency eligibility.

Residency: The Core of Diagnostic Training

After medical school, the next major phase is a diagnostic radiology residency, which typically lasts four years. This period is essential for building a broad foundation in all aspects of radiology, from interpreting chest X-rays to managing complex oncologic cases. Residents gain hands-on experience with various imaging modalities, including CT, MRI, and ultrasound, while also learning to integrate clinical data to form accurate diagnoses. This general training is the necessary bedrock upon which the subspecialty of neuroradiology is built.

Subspecialty Fellowship: Focusing on the Nervous System

The One to Two Year Fellowship

To become a true neuroradiologist, an additional one to two year fellowship is mandatory after completing the diagnostic radiology residency. This specialized training is where the focus narrows exclusively to the brain, spine, and head and neck. Fellows engage deeply in the interpretation of complex neurological scans, mastering the detection of subtle strokes, intricate tumor pathologies, and congenital anomalies. The duration often depends on the specific program, with some emphasizing surgical pathology correlations and others focusing on advanced neurointerventional techniques.

Key Components of the Fellowship

Advanced interpretation of cross-sectional imaging (MRI and CT).

Comprehensive study of cerebrovascular diseases and trauma.

Hands-on experience with image-guided procedures.

Multidisciplinary collaboration with neurosurgeons and neurologists.

The Total Time Commitment

When calculating the total duration, the timeline becomes clear. The standard route involves four years of medical school, followed by four years of diagnostic radiology residency, and capped by a one to two year neuroradiology fellowship. This places the total timeline at approximately nine to eleven years after undergraduate graduation. While this path requires patience and perseverance, it cultivates the expertise necessary to manage the most intricate cases in neuroimaging.

Certification and Career Integration

The final step in this journey is obtaining board certification, which involves rigorous examinations administered by the American Board of Radiology or its equivalent bodies. Achieving this certification validates the extensive training completed and is often a prerequisite for hospital privileges and attending positions. Once certified, neuroradiologists find opportunities in academic centers, large hospital networks, and private practices, where they play a critical role in guiding patient management and advancing neurological science.
